Hyssop - medicinal properties and contraindications

Hyssopus Officinalis - hyssop ordinary (blue tutsan or bee grass), a plant of a wide profile of application. Due to the fact that it is not whimsical and the whole summer season pleases with flowering and aroma, it is used to decorate home gardens. It also attracts the attention of bees (great honey). Fees on natural habitat are full of useful properties. In nature, there are more than 50 species of plants.Common and frequent are such varieties: Cretaceous, anise and medicinal. Value for healing and cooking represents the latter.

Curative grass belonging to the family of yasnotkovykh, most often large plantations grows in Asia, in the south of Siberia, central Russia, in the Caucasus, Crimea, Kazakhstan, in the Altai Mountains. For medicinal purposes, use all the elements of the plant. The value is a flower, stem and root system. During the flowering season, and this is the period from June to September, you can make several sections of the plant. Collection knit beams and hang in well-ventilated areas, or on the street under a canopy, without access of moisture and sunlight.

Composition

To be able to determine the direction in use, the chemical composition of the plant was studied:

  1. Essential oil. The method of distillation of steam from the leaves of the plant extract oil. The consistency of it is viscous and light, has a yellow-green color. Due to the tart and sweet fragrance, it can be used in aromatherapy and has a positive effect on the general condition of the body.Cheers up and gives strength. The healing properties of the volatile component can help cope with asthma, bronchitis, angina. Oil rubbing is widely used for colds. With nervous exhaustion, depression - adding a few drops to the bath is shown. It is recommended to conduct external treatment of wounds, hematomas, acne, eczema, warts.
  2. Tannins. Tannins are a component of many plants and are found in all their parts. They have an astringent effect and, reaching the intestines, help to cure dysbacteriosis, stop the activity of pathogenic microbes, remove slags and toxins, the effect of radiation, promote the absorption of necessary, beneficial substances.
  3. Diosmin. Flavonoid, a medicine of natural origin. Contributes to the narrowing of the vessels of norepinephrine on the venous walls. Increases the tone and lowers the venous capacity.
  4. Issopin. Flavonoid activates the body's enzymes. Widely applicable in traditional and traditional medicine. Antioxidant. It is appreciated for its ability to maintain the cardiovascular system, prolong youth and even life.
  5. Hesperidin. Natural natural medicine that strengthens blood vessels and improves blood circulation. Applied to prevent the pathology of veins. The strongest cardioprotector.
  6. Resins They are similar in composition to the essential oil. In uncured form - balm. They have a wide spectrum of action: bactericidal, laxative, anthelmintic, wound healing.
  7. Vitamins. The composition has a large proportion of ascorbic acid, as well as A, B, E, PP, K and D.
  8. Trace elements - manganese, selenium, copper, calcium, iron, chlorine, boron, fluorine, flint, tungsten.
  9. Ursolic acid - often used in sports circles and an excellent means of obesity. It is an inhibitor of cancer cells. It has ant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, hepatoprotective, immunomodulating, antitumor properties.

Bulgarian herbalists use the collection as an expectorant, for constipation, dyspepsia, anemia. Doctors prescribe a healing substance for intestinal catarrh, chronic bronchitis, sweating. Antimicrobial properties are appreciated.

France, Germany, Romania, Sweden and Portugal officially included hyssop (tops of stems, leaves, flowers) in their pharmacopoeias.

Contraindications to the use of hyssop

Any treatment must begin with a list of contraindications. This plant is not an exception and has its own nuances that require attention.

It is important to know that hyssop belongs to poorly-tolerant plants and requires the use of a serious and respectful attitude. The correct step would be to consult a doctor and a preliminary examination. Sometimes an individual approach and dosage is required.

What to look for:

  • You can not continuously, for a long time to take the drug.
  • For epilepsy, treatment with this collection is contraindicated.
  • Disruption of dosage and excessive use can cause cramps.
  • People with kidney disease cannot use herbs for medicinal purposes.
  • Hypertensive patients do not prescribe the use of hyssop.
  • Increased acidity - is the reason to refuse to use.
  • Children under 12 years old are not allowed to take it.
  • Lactation can completely stop under the action of a substance.

Pregnancy. The collection, taken in any form, can cause spontaneous interruption of gestation.

For therapeutic purposes, the components of the collection are used in various forms: decoctions, tinctures, tinctures.

 Decoction hyssop

  1. Tincture (cough, asthma and bronchitis): 20 g of crushed, dried herbs, pour vodka in the amount of glass, shaken and insist seven days in a dark place. Filter through gauze and use three times a day, 1 teaspoonful, for two weeks. It is not recommended to extend the course for a longer time, as it is possible to provoke an allergy.
  2. Broth herb hyssop (with menopause). It has been observed that by using the decoction from grass gathering, menopausal symptoms are more easily tolerated. The recipe is as follows: 1 tbsp. spoon spoon filled with two glasses of boiling water, churned and infused hour. Strain, decoction consumed in a heated form twice a day for half a glass.
  3. Decoction of grass (for colds): 2 teaspoons of flowers or herbs pour a glass of boiling water. Insist hour, strain. Take 1/3 cup three times a day during the week.
  4. Hyssop mixture (with choking): Dry harvest to crush to a fine fraction and mix in equal parts with honey. Taking a mixture of a teaspoon three times a day before meals, you can recover from shortness of breath and noise in the ear.
  5. Tincture (with Koch wand and helminthiasis): 20 g of crushed collection mixed with a glass of vodka or 40 degree alcohol.Set aside for 10 days in a dark place. Pass through cheesecloth and use a teaspoon 3 times a day. Applying the course for a month, you can achieve a positive effect.

For overall development ...

  1. For the first time this grass was mentioned in the Bible. It was used as a sprinkler in the composition of the holy water by the Jews. With it, the rite of purification was performed.
  2. In Russia, the interest was shown by the clergy. Hyssop was grown in monasteries and used in church rituals.
  3. Quite often, this plant serves as an additive in the manufacture of alcohol and fruit drinks.
